Examining Lifecycles to Uncover Carbon Footprint Reductions

Performing thorough lifecycle analysis is crucial for accurately evaluating the total carbon footprint of footwear products. By scrutinizing each stage—from material sourcing and manufacturing to usage and final disposal—you can identify essential areas for improvement. For example, the emissions related to barefoot shoes typically range from 10-20 kg CO₂e per pair, showcasing a remarkable 40% reduction compared to conventional athletic footwear. Initiatives like Vivobarefoot’s ReVivo program, which extends the lifespan of shoes, successfully reduces emissions to just 5.8 kg CO₂e, exemplifying the substantial benefits sustainability measures can provide for production efficiency and consumer appeal.

How Minimalist Footwear Designs Enhance Gait and Movement Efficiency

Minimalist designs featured in barefoot shoes promote a natural gait that encourages midfoot or forefoot striking patterns. This adjustment can significantly lessen the impact force on your joints, leading to a more efficient and enjoyable walking or running experience. By eliminating excessive cushioning and support, these shoes allow your foot muscles to engage more fully, strengthening the intrinsic musculature essential for optimal movement. Grasping Compliance Mandates: A Catalyst for Sustainable Practices

Emerging compliance mandates, particularly within the European Union, are establishing a framework for sustainable practices across the footwear industry. By 2027, regulations will necessitate a minimum of 20% recycled content in footwear materials, while by 2026, carbon labeling will become mandatory for all athletic shoes. These guidelines compel brands to rethink their material sourcing, production processes, and end-of-life strategies, ensuring greater accountability and environmental stewardship within the industry.

On-Demand Production: Customization and the Role of 3D Printing in Sustainable Footwear

On-demand production harnesses 3D printing technology to create footwear tailored specifically to meet your unique needs. This groundbreaking approach not only permits a customized fit but also drastically reduces waste associated with traditional manufacturing processes. By utilizing advanced 3D printing techniques, brands can produce shoes that accurately reflect individual foot dimensions based on pressure mapping and other biometric data. This high level of customization reduces the chances of returns and excess inventory, with studies suggesting a 73% reduction in waste through on-demand manufacturing practices. Moreover, localized production diminishes transportation emissions and bolsters regional economies.
